Among all the enormous experiences that Georges St-Pierre has lived in UFC choose one of them as your favorite souvenir. Anyone would think that is impossible considering that he is one of the greatest legends of all time. He won the 170-pound world championship twice (and the interim one). Won the 185 pound world championship. He is a member of the Hall of Fame. He has broken records: most wins in welterweight title fights (12), most victorious in this division (19) … But remember with special fondness when he defeated Matt Serra in his rematch at UFC 83 in 2008 to win the 170-pound belt for the second time and unify him with the interim. So I said recently to BT Sport.

Georges St-Pierre’s favorite UFC memory

β€œThere are so many, but my number one is when I beat Matt Serra in Montreal (at UFC 83) because It was at the time when the sport was not really accepted by the media, and after that night, everything changed. And it was a great opportunity for me to perform in front of all my family and friends.
